UNEMPLOYMENT INSURANCE WEEKLY CLAIMS - SEASONALLY ADJUSTED DATA

April 17, 2025 - In the week ending April 12, the advance figure for seasonally adjusted initial claims was 215,000, a decrease of 9,000 from the previous week's department of labor seal logorevised level. The previous week's level was revised up by 1,000 from 223,000 to 224,000. The 4-week moving average was 220,750, a decrease of 2,500 from the previous week's revised average. The previous week's average was revised up by 250 from 223,000 to 223,250.

The advance seasonally adjusted insured unemployment rate was 1.2 percent for the week ending April 5, unchanged from the previous week's unrevised rate. The advance number for seasonally adjusted insured unemployment during the week ending April 5 was 1,885,000, an increase of 41,000 from the previous week's revised level. The previous week's level was revised down by 6,000 from 1,850,000 to 1,844,000. The 4-week moving average was 1,867,250, an increase of 1,000 from the previous week's revised average. The previous week's average was revised down by 1,500 from 1,867,750 to 1,866,250.
